#6c17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c17ff is composed of 42.4% red, 9%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.6% cyan, 91%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 262 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 54.5%. #6c17ff color hex could be obtained by blending #d82eff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

● #6c17ff color description : Vivid violet.
#6c17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c17ff has RGB values of R:108, G:23,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 7084031.
